Ten Dam to stay with Belkin until 2015

The Belkin team has announced that Laurens ten Dam will stay with the Netherlands based team for another two years. The lanky Dutchman finished thirteenth overall in the Tour de France, 21:39 behind Chris Froome (Team Sky) but impressed in the first part of the race, helping Bauke Mollema finish eighth overall. He finished eighth overall in last year's Vuelta a Espana and will target the Spanish Grand Tour this year alongside Mollema.
